Action item (Verdigris GPU incident): our profiling tool, Memgauge, sampled too coarsely to catch the fragmentation spike before OOM. Fix: raise sampling frequency during training warmup, cap snapshot retention, add alloc-site tagging. Owner: Priya, due next sprint. Proposed sampler constants follow.

limits module of kahag-fajop:
QUOTAS = {
    "wenwyn": 10,
    "zorath": 1,
}

Handover — Vexler partner SFTP drop

Ownership moves to you today. Drop runs hourly from Vexler's end into the intake bucket via the relay host. Watch for zero-byte files; their exporter flakes on Mondays. Creds live in the ops vault, path noted in the runbook. Vault auto-seals after 48h idle. Support escalations go to the on-call rotation, not me. If the vault is sealed when you need it, unseal with the recovery passphrase below.

recovery phrase for tadug-fafof: zorwyn-kasion

## Runbook: Fernwire Websocket Reconnect Loop

If clients report repeated disconnects, check the `session_state` table for rows stuck in `RECONNECTING` older than five minutes. Clearing stale rows forces a clean handshake; the Fernwire gateway picks this up within thirty seconds. To inspect and clear affected sessions, connect using the string below.

replica DSN, kajep-yahag: mssql://praok_svc:iF@db-8d68.plorvaio.local:5432/eliion